If you do a search on *all* of the smaller BG planars you'll see a wide variety of opinions.


This is almost exclusively do to implementation.

Any time you use a rear chamber on the drivers you are likely subjecting them to compromises in overall sound quality.

Any time you use them open baffle they are HUGELY dependent on the baffle and summing with other drivers.

On top of all this the larger drivers not only have a rising response, but they also operate as line-sources at higher freq.s..
